Are dog trolleys safe?

Tangling and Choking The trolley wire can tangle the dogs, cutting off blood circulation to their limbs or the ability to breathe If the trolley run uses a nylon or leather cable to leash the dog to the trolley, the dog can chew through the cable or choke on bits and pieces of the hardware.

How do you hold a large dog down?

Place one hand under the dog’s neck and onto the head. Pass your other arm under the dog’s abdomen, close to the hindlimbs, and place your hand on the flank on the far side. Hold the dog towards yourself, supporting the dog by cradling it between your arms and body.

How do you chain a dog in a yard?

A leather collar is best and should be fitted to a swivel which is then attached to a tether of approximately three metres in length Only metal chain tethers should be used as they provide greater security; rope and other tethers may fray, break or tangle.

Is it cruel to keep a dog chained up?

According to the U.S. Department of Agriculture, “Our experience in enforcing the Animal Welfare Act has led us to conclude that continuous confinement of dogs by a tether is inhumane A tether significantly restricts the dog’s movement.

Do dogs get runners high?

A 2012 study in Journal of Experimental Biology showed that canines get the same “runner’s high” after intense exercise that people experience “Exercise is physical and mental stimulation,” said Noon Kampani, a veterinarian with AtlasVet animal hospital in the District. “It gives them an activity and burns energy.
